"Like, I won't mention it to anybody if you won't. But I goofed, all right. Didn't you see the picture?" "But whatever you did ... it worked," Mr. Rapp said. "The picture's right side up." "I know," the repairman said. "Only somewhere ... there's a studio that's upside down. I just goofed, Pops, that's all." He closed the door behind him, leaving Mr. Rapp still staring at the immobile, right-side-up message on the glowing screen. [Illustration] The End.
